About the role

The successful candidate will oversee a portfolio of 10-15 school sites in Queens and Brooklyn during the school year and lead a Brooklyn-based summer camp serving 100-150+ children. The role is full-time, overtime-exempt, and based in New York City.

Responsibilities

  • Oversee a portfolio of 10-15+ recess, PE & sports classes, and after school programs in Queens and Brooklyn
  • Provide scheduled and emergency coverage for coach absences at recess, PE, and sports classes
  • Provide scheduled and emergency coverage for Site Coordinator absences at after-school programs
  • Travel regularly between schools in Queens and Brooklyn to ensure high program standards and provide hands-on support
  • Act as a key point of contact for school administrators, ensuring program quality and maintaining strong relationships
  • Provide direct support to 30-40 part-time coaches through site visits, training, performance evaluations, and regular check-ins
  • Collaborate with leadership to design and refine programming based on school needs, community input, and industry trends
  • Identify opportunities for program expansion or improvement within existing school partnerships
  • Manage program operations, including scheduling, curriculum implementation, and staff deployment
  • Host workshops, team-building events, and professional development sessions for part-time staff
  • Oversee performance management for 30+ part-time coaches and 3-5 full-time team members
  • Oversee day-to-day operations of a Brooklyn-based summer camp (Park Slope, Greenpoint, Fort Greene) with 80–130+ campers and 25–35+ staff members
  • Lead staff training and onboarding, ensuring alignment with our mission and values
  • Implement dynamic weekly schedules, including sports, arts, STEM, field trips, and special events
  • Serve as the primary point of contact for parents, campers, and staff, handling concerns and fostering a positive camp culture
  • Maintain compliance with safety and operational standards, including attendance tracking, health documentation, and emergency procedures
  • Conduct staff evaluations and provide ongoing feedback to promote growth and development
  • Implement surveying methods to assess program impact and parent satisfaction
  • Collaborate with internal teams to ensure smooth operations, enrollment, and marketing efforts

Requirements

  • A Bachelor’s Degree in Education, Sports Management, Child Development, or a related field (preferred); Master’s Degree in a related field is highly desirable.
  • 5+ years of experience in youth development, including 3+ years in a managerial role overseeing a portfolio of school-based programs or camps.
  • Proven success in managing diverse teams, with experience in training, performance management, and conflict resolution.
  • Strong organizational and communication skills, with the ability to manage multiple programs across a wide geographic region.
  • Familiarity with Queens and Brooklyn communities and an understanding of their unique needs.
  • Experience developing and implementing creative and engaging programming for children of all ages.
  • Exceptional organizational and administrative skills, with the ability to manage multiple calendars, participant data, payments, budgets, and multi-channel communications.
  • Proficiency in G Suite, Asana, and other digital tools for communication, project management, and program administration.
  • Ability to communicate effectively with families from diverse backgrounds, including non-English-speaking customers (Spanish proficiency is highly desirable).
  • Flexibility to work evenings or weekends as needed to supervise sports programs, train staff, and conduct site observations.

Pay

Total Compensation: Annual base salary in the range of $68,000 - $73,000. Candidates will be eligible for the higher end of the salary range if they have prior experience in a role with an equivalent scope of work. Semi-annual bonuses of $1,500 - $3,000 pending company performance. Annual performance-based salary raises of 3-6% pending individual performance. Comprehensive benefits package valued at $11,000 (including 15 days of paid time off, public holidays, 401K, commuter benefits, health insurance + HSA, and wellness program). Free and discounted weeks of camp for your children and/or eligible relatives.

Schedule

This is a full-time, overtime-exempt role based in New York City and requires in-person work. Program Managers should expect to split their time between office work & meetings, site visits, site supervision, and other administrative tasks.
